Output 8d8c42c1d3111169f771fc55a176578b13a4db57794fedc278eb95d276acf353:7

value
105205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ad7830603ae73b08ace790b83c53851c237a5040 OP_EQUAL
address
3HWEoc7yYuwFQz6fDLgbqAJsUmJkPsos38
transaction
8d8c42c1d3111169f771fc55a176578b13a4db57794fedc278eb95d276acf353